Over the course of his 30-year career, TJ Douglas has worked on all sides of the hospitality industry - including restaurant management, distribution, and beverage retail. TJ uses his decades of experience to lead several groundbreaking wine industry businesses, all of which are dedicated to creating community through beverage.
Along with his wife, Hadley, TJ is the founder of The Urban Grape, an award-winning wine store in the South End neighborhood of Boston, in 2010. The store concept is simple, but revolutionary – Drink Progressively. The store's proprietary Progressive Scale system organizes wine by its body, instead of by varietal or region.
The Urban Grape has become one of the most successful independently-owned wine stores in the country as a result, and was named the United States Small Business of the Year in 2021. The Urban Grape is also a 4-time Top 100 Wine Retail Store in America winner, a 2-time Wine Enthusiast Wine Star Nominee, a 5-time ICIC Inner City 100 winner, and a 6-time Best of Boston winner. The store has been nationally profiled in Food & Wine, The New York Times, NPR, Wine Spectator, and Wine Enthusiast, among others. TJ and Hadley were named EY Entrepreneurs of the Year in 2021. In 2023, TJ was a Wine Enthusiast Future 40 winner.
